Alpha-mannosidase-II deficiency results in dyserythropoiesis and unveils an alternate pathway in oligosaccharide biosynthesis

Article Abstract:

The biological function of alpha-mannosidase-II (alphaM-II) was analyzed during the synthesis of complexed asparagine-linked oligosaccharides in alphaM-II mutant mice. Genetic deficiency in alphaM-II induced the disappearance of erythrocyte complex N-glycans. However, alphaM-II gene deficiency did not inhibit the synthesis of complex asparagine-linked oligosaccharides in nonerythroid cells due to cell-specific variations in N-linked oligosaccharide formation.

Dietary and genetic control of glucose transporter 2 glycosylation promotes insulin secretion in suppressing diabetes

Article Abstract:

Pancreatic beta cell-surface expression of glucose transporter 2(Glut-2) is essential for glucose-stimulated insulin secretion, thereby controlling blood glucose homeostasis in response to dietary intake. Beta cell glucose-transporter glycosylation mediates a link between diet and insulin production that typically suppresses the pathogenesis of type 2 diabetes.

Developmentally regulated glycosylation of the CD8(alpha)(beta) coreceptor stalk modulates ligand binding

Article Abstract:

Research has been conducted on the glycan structural changes associated with the cellular differentiation. The role of the glycan adducts to the O-glycosylated polypeptide stalk tethering the CD8(alpha)(beta) coreceptor to the thymocyte surface has been investigated and the results are reported.
